Why Batch Consistency Matters for Bulk Buyers
A sample may perform well, but mass production can still create problems if the supplier does not control materials, dimensions, terminals, and electrical performance consistently.
Common batch problems include:
- Different heating speeds
- Power variation
- Terminal position changes
- Inconsistent mounting holes
- Surface scratches or coating defects
- Product deformation
- Incorrect labels
- Mixed models inside cartons
- Packaging damage during transportation
These problems can increase incoming inspection costs and delay appliance production. For distributors, they may lead to returns and customer complaints.
A reliable solid hot plate bulk supplier should use the approved sample, technical specification, drawing, and packaging instructions as the reference for every production batch.
Key Specifications to Confirm Before a Bulk Order
Buyers should not place a bulk order based only on product diameter or appearance.
| Specification | Why It Matters |
| Diameter | Determines compatibility with the appliance housing |
| Voltage | Must match the destination market |
| Rated power | Influences heating speed and performance |
| Terminal type | Must fit the electrical connection |
| Terminal position | Affects wiring and assembly efficiency |
| Mounting structure | Ensures stable installation |
| Surface finish | Influences durability and appearance |
| Control compatibility | Must match the selected switch or regulator |
| Certification needs | Supports customer and market requirements |
| Packaging method | Protects the product during delivery |
Common solid hot plate categories may include 90mm, 110mm, and 145mm options. However, buyers should also confirm voltage, power, terminals, installation structure, and application before selecting a model.

4. Examine Quality-Control Procedures
A professional solid hot plate bulk supplier should control quality throughout production rather than relying only on a final visual inspection.
Important inspection points include:
- Incoming material inspection
- Product dimension checks
- Surface inspection
- Power testing
- Electrical continuity checks
- Insulation testing
- Terminal inspection
- Heating performance evaluation
- Packaging and quantity checks
For bulk orders, sampling standards and inspection records should be discussed before production.

Why Export Packaging Matters
Solid hot plates are relatively heavy metal components with exposed terminals. Weak packaging may create damage during warehousing, loading, transportation, and unloading.
Possible shipping problems include:
- Scratched heating surfaces
- Bent terminals
- Deformed housings
- Broken cartons
- Mixed models
- Missing labels
- Moisture exposure
- Difficult warehouse identification
Bulk buyers should confirm:
- Individual product protection
- Internal dividers
- Carton strength
- Quantity per carton
- Model labels
- Barcode requirements
- Carton marks
- Pallet requirements
- Private label packaging
Packaging quality should be included in the supplier evaluation because damaged products increase the real cost of the order.
Cost Factors in a Bulk Solid Hot Plate Order
The unit price is important, but it is not the only cost.
The total purchasing cost may include:
- Sample development
- Custom specification changes
- Tooling requirements
- Quality inspection
- Product packaging
- Private label materials
- Export cartons
- Pallets
- Freight and insurance
- Import duties
- Rework or replacement claims
- Inventory losses caused by incompatible products
A lower unit price may not create real savings if it leads to inconsistent quality, damaged shipments, or high return rates.
